Base64 Encode / Decode-Tool
Kodieren Sie Text in Base64 oder decodieren Sie Base64 wieder in lesbare Inhalte direkt in Ihrem Browser. Es ist nützlich für die Überprüfung von Token, debugging Autorisierungs-Header, Überprüfung von Config-Werten, Dekodierung API-Payloads und Umwandlung von Klartext ohne Verwendung eines Remote-Service. ToolMill läuft komplett auf Client-Seite für die Privatsphäre und arbeitet nach der Installation weiterhin offline.
Kodierung
Versuchen Sie es
Beispiele
Hello, ToolMill!
SGVsbG8sIFRvb2xNaWxsIQ==
VGhpcyBpcyBhIGJhc2U2NCBkZWNvZGUgdGVzdC4=
Dies ist ein Base64 Decode-Test.
YWRtaW46ZGVtbw==
admin:demo
{"mode":"demo","enabled":true}
eyJtb2RlIjoiZGVtbyIsImVuYWJsZWQiOnRydWV9
Was Base64 ist und wann es zu benutzen
Base64 verwandelt Bytes in ein begrenztes ASCII-Zeichen-Set, so dass Text sicher durch Systeme, die Klartext erwarten. Das macht es nützlich für kopierte Header-Werte, Konfigurations-Strings, API-Proben, E-Mail-Stil-Payloads und Debug-Ausgabe. Base64 ändert die Darstellung, nicht Geheimhaltung, so sollte es nie als Verschlüsselung behandelt werden.
Gemeinsame Arbeitsabläufe
Prüfen Sie einen Basic Authorization Header
Eine gemeinsame Debugging-Task überprüft einen kopierten Basis-Auth-Wert. In diesem Format werden ein einfacher Text Benutzername und Passwort mit einem Kolon verbunden und dann als Base64 kodiert. Diese Seite ist nützlich, wenn Sie bestätigen müssen, was ein kopiertes Header tatsächlich enthält, bevor Sie eine andere Anfrage senden.
Inspect API oder config Werte
Viele Systeme speichern kurze Text Nutzlasten, Umgebungswerte oder kopierte Musterdaten in Base64-Form. Decoding hilft Ihnen, zu überprüfen, was tatsächlich vorhanden ist, während die Neucodierung ermöglicht es Ihnen, kleine Bearbeitungen zu testen, ohne für einen anderen Service oder Kommandozeilen-Tool zu erreichen.
Klartext für den Transport vorbereiten
Erwartet ein System den Base64-Text, können Sie lesbare Inhalte hier einfügen und ihn vor dem Einbetten in ein Anfrage-, Aufnahme- oder Dokumentationsbeispiel umwandeln. Dieses Tool ist besonders praktisch für kurze Textproben und kopierte Snippets anstatt volle binäre Dateien.
Eingangsregeln und Randfälle
Diese Seite ist textorientiert. Es funktioniert gut für lesbare Strings und Unicode Text, und der Decoder ignoriert Leerzeichen und Zeilenumbrüche in der Vergangenheit Base64 Eingabe. Standard Base64 wird hier erwartet, so dass URL-sichere Varianten, die verschiedene Zeichen verwenden, zuerst konvertiert werden müssen. Auch das Padding ist wichtig: Fehlende oder beschädigte Gleichzeichen können Decodierungsfehler verursachen.
Warum Decodierung versagt
Decode-Ausfälle bedeuten in der Regel, dass der eingefügte Wert nicht-Base64-Zeichen, falsche Polsterung, einen gekürzten String oder eine Base64URL-Variante enthält, die in einen Standard-Base64-Decoder kopiert wurde. Eine weitere gemeinsame Quelle von Verwirrung ist die Dekodierung gültiger Base64, die binäre Daten anstelle von human lesbaren Texten darstellt.
Datenschutz und Offline-Nutzung
Bevor Sie auf verschlüsselte oder decodierte Daten
Bevor Sie die Ausgabe wieder verwenden, bestätigen Sie die Originaltextcodierung, überprüfen Sie, ob die Quelle Standard Base64 oder eine Variante wie Base64URL war, und überprüfen Sie, ob die erforderlichen Padding- oder Datei-Erwartungen dem Zielsystem entsprechen. Dadurch wird vermieden, dass die technisch gültige Ausgabe in den falschen Workflow kopiert wird.
Was Base64 Decode Ergebnisse tun und nicht beweisen
Ein erfolgreicher Decode beweist nur, dass die Eingabe als Base64 interpretiert und in diesem Tool wieder in Bytes oder Text umgewandelt werden könnte. Es beweist nicht, dass das decodierte Ergebnis aussagekräftig, vertrauenswürdig, korrekt kodiert für Ihre nachgeschaltete App, oder geeignet für direkte Wiederverwendung ohne Inspektion.
Wie Base64 Output richtig interpretieren
Base64 Ausgang ist nur eine Textdarstellung von Bytes. Es beweist nicht, dass der ursprüngliche Inhalt lesbarer Text, sicher, geheim oder sogar zur Anzeige bestimmt war. Der Hauptwert des Ergebnisses ist, dass es in Systeme kopiert werden kann, die Base64 als Transport- oder Speicherformat erwarten.
Weil ToolMill im Browser läuft, können Sie kopierte Token, Header, config snippets und kurze Nutzlasten inspizieren, ohne sie an eine andere Website zu senden. Das ist besonders nützlich, wenn der Text interne Werte enthält, die Sie beim Debuggen lieber lokal halten würden.
Andere Werkzeuge
Hex Encode / Decode — Text ≠ Hex
Hex Encode / Decode konvertiert Text in hexadezimale (base-16) Bytes und dekodiert Hex zurück in lesbarer Text. Verwenden Sie es zum Debuggen binärer Nutzlasten, inspizieren von UTF-8 Bytes, reversieren von entkommenen Strings und arbeiten mit Hashes oder Low-Level-Protokollen. Akzeptiert häufige Hex-Formate (mit oder ohne Leerzeichen, Newlines oder 0x Präfixes). Runs 100% lokal in Ihrem Browser – keine Uploads – und arbeitet offline nach der Installation von ToolMill als PWA.
Kodierung
HTML Entity Encode / Decode — Escape & Unescape HTML
HTML Entity Encode / Decode converts special characters like <, >, &, and quotes into safe HTML entities (and decodes them back). Use it when working with HTML attributes, templates, CMS editors, Markdown docs, or when debugging copy/paste issues. Handles common named entities (e.g. <, >, &, ") and numeric entities. Runs 100% locally in your browser — no uploads — and works offline after installing ToolMill as a PWA.
Kodierung
ROT13 Encode / Decode — Text ≠ ROT13 Cipher
ROT13 ist eine einfache Briefsubstitutions-Cipherie, die A≠N, BENDO usw. verschiebt. Es wird häufig für Spoiler, Lichtobfuskation und Forum/E-Mail-Text verwendet. Dieses Tool kodiert Klartext zu ROT13 und dekodiert ROT13 zurück zu Text (die Operation ist symmetrisch). Runs 100% lokal in Ihrem Browser – keine Uploads – und arbeitet offline nach der Installation von ToolMill als PWA.
Kodierung
URL Encode / Decode (Percent-Encoding)
URL Encode/Decode (percent-encoding) konvertiert unsichere Zeichen in ein URL-sicheres Format und wieder zurück. Verwenden Sie es für Abfragestrings, Umleitung von URLs, UTM-Parametern und Debugging API-Anfragen (RFC 3986). Runs 100% lokal in Ihrem Browser – keine Uploads – und arbeitet offline nach der Installation von ToolMill als PWA.
Kodierung
